Community service is a charitable act and a strategic move that builds lasting relationships with the local community. By actively participating in community initiatives, businesses can establish themselves as integral members of society, fostering a sense of trust and loyalty among customers and stakeholders. This strong connection goes beyond mere transactions, creating a positive atmosphere that can lead to increased customer retention and word-of-mouth referrals.
Brand reputation is a critical component of a company's success. A positive reputation can act as a magnet, attracting both customers and talented employees. Community service projects offer businesses a unique opportunity to showcase their commitment to social responsibility. When a company invests time and resources in initiatives that benefit the community, it sends a clear message that it is more than a profit-driven entity. This positive image attracts customers and resonates with employees increasingly seeking employers with a strong sense of purpose.
In a competitive business environment, standing out is crucial. Community service provides a distinct avenue for differentiation. Consumers are more likely to choose a brand that actively contributes to the community's well-being when faced with similar products or services. This differentiation can give businesses a competitive edge and help them carve out a unique identity in the market.
Engaging in community service is not only beneficial for external relationships but also has a profound impact on internal dynamics. Employees who participate in community service initiatives often experience increased job satisfaction and a sense of pride in their workplace. This positive morale translates into improved productivity, collaboration, and teamwork. Moreover, community service provides employees opportunities for personal and professional development, fostering a positive work culture that attracts and retains top talent.
